guida rapida actools e i primi bot (oh, vecchi ricordi...) By Erre

Vedere l'argomento precedente Vedere l'argomento seguente Andare in basso

guida rapida actools e i primi bot (oh, vecchi ricordi...) By Erre

Messaggio  xXPownerXx il Mar Dic 08, 2009 10:50 pm

iniziamo a dire che per iniziare a creare qualcosa di non pensare ad un

multi hack, io nn insegno a creare dei bot ma insegno la base per

crearli. non pensate che dopo aver letto questa guda sarete capaci di

fare un qualsiasi bot , si fa tutto con la pratica.


all'inizzio consiglio ACtools scaricambile qui:
[Devi essere iscritto e connesso per vedere questo link]
cosa è?
è un programma con un linguaggio molto semplice anche se privo di

intestazione grafica.

io ho iniziato con un semplice spamm bot:

keys ciao
keys {return}
delay 4000
restart

cosa ho fatto????
keys è la chiave dove si inseriscono le lettere o pulsanti che il

computer deve riprodurre adesso premerà la lettera C I A O in parole

povere significa PREMI

delay vuol dire pausa e il numero difianco pausa x quanto tempo? contato

in millisecondi quindi
4000 è uguale a 4 secondi

keys {return} keys come ho detto prima è colei che definisce una lettera

o un pulsante sulla tastiera purtroppo eccetto le lettere il resto dei

pulsanti è inglese come in questo caso i pulsanti vanno sotto apparentesi

grafe {} e return significa invio

restart sigifica ricomincia da capo

alla fine dirà

premi i pulsanti C, I, A, O
premi invio
aspetta 4 secondi
ricomincia da capo
premi i pulsanti C, I, A, O
premi invio
aspetta 4 secondi
ricomincia da capo
premi i pulsanti C, I, A, O
premi invio
aspetta 4 secondi
ricomincia da capo
ecc.. ecc.. ecc..

actool non ha il concetto di infinito quindi si avrà sempre il problema

di premere quel maledetto pause!

le lettere sono:
abcdefghkjlmnopqrsvwyxz1234567890
i pulsanti:
{return} = invio
{space} = sbarra
{f1}, {f2}, {f3}... = premi f1, f2...
{left} = tasto direzzionale sinistro
{right} = tasto direzionale destro
{up} = tasto direzionale in su
{dowun} = tasto direzzionale in giu

questi dono i principali e io sinceramente nn ne ho usati altri x i bot

ma cene sono un infinità


nota BN:
dopo keys = preme 1 singola volta la lettera o pulsante
in alcuni casi derve keydown che vuol dire tenere premuto
ce una differenza bella e buona tra questi 2
ma il piu usato e keys
keydown lo si usa per spostare il personaggio oppure per lo {space} sui

bot pesca...

ora passiamo al piu fondamentale elemento di actools che serve al 88% per

la creazione dei bot:

mousepos + coordinata dei pixel del dekstop

un esempio:
mousepos 600,500

non demoralizzatevi le coordinate le si prendono premendo ctrl+m

sull'ononimo programma, ogni minuscolo pixel del dekstop ha una

coordinata e un colore ma il COLORE ne parliamo dopo.

in questo caso
mousepos 600,500 dice al puntatore (la freccetta) di andare nel punto in

cui avete scelto la coordinata premendo ctrl + m

vi faccio un esempio:



Codice:
MousePos 101, 133
delay 500
MousePos 183, 133
delay 500
MousePos 188, 133
delay 500
MousePos 191, 133
delay 500
MousePos 191, 133
delay 500
MousePos 191, 133
delay 500
MousePos 191, 133
delay 500
MousePos 193, 133
delay 500
MousePos 228, 140
delay 500
MousePos 257, 147
delay 500
MousePos 288, 158
delay 500
MousePos 305, 160
delay 500
MousePos 330, 160
delay 500
MousePos 348, 160
delay 500
MousePos 349, 160
delay 500
MousePos 349, 160
delay 500
MousePos 349, 160
delay 500
MousePos 349, 160
delay 500
MousePos 349, 160
delay 500
MousePos 349, 159
delay 500
MousePos 383, 156
delay 500
MousePos 401, 154
delay 500
MousePos 413, 153
delay 500
MousePos 423, 153
delay 500
MousePos 429, 152
delay 500
MousePos 439, 149
delay 500
MousePos 457, 146
delay 500
MousePos 472, 145
delay 500
MousePos 475, 145
delay 500
MousePos 475, 145
delay 500
MousePos 475, 145
delay 500
MousePos 475, 145
delay 500
MousePos 481, 145
delay 500
MousePos 518, 142
delay 500
MousePos 554, 140
delay 500
MousePos 572, 141
delay 500
MousePos 589, 143
delay 500
MousePos 609, 143
delay 500
MousePos 616, 143
delay 500
MousePos 627, 143
delay 500
MousePos 629, 143
delay 500
MousePos 629, 143
delay 500
MousePos 629, 143
delay 500
MousePos 629, 143
delay 500
MousePos 633, 142
delay 500
MousePos 667, 140
delay 500
MousePos 699, 140
delay 500
MousePos 718, 140
delay 500
MousePos 721, 140
delay 500
MousePos 721, 140
delay 500
MousePos 732, 140
delay 500
provate ad inserirlo nella pagina di actool e startizzarlo dove ce

scritto start in basso a destra, vi sembrera lungo ma ho preso le

coordinate a casaccio comunque vedrete che ogni mezzo secondo il

puntatore si muovera da solo nelle coordinate elencate.

una volta mosso il puntatore si può fargli premere il tasto destro o

sinistro del mouse con il comando
leftclick = tasto sinistro
rightclick = tasto destro

in questo caso nn serve ne grafa e ne keys vi faccio un esempio:


MousePos 35, 23
leftclick
MousePos 979, 18
leftclick

ora il puntatore prenderà l'icona in alto a sinistra del Desktop e la

porterà in alto a destra.

smanettate un po col mousepos è troppo figo...

ora passiamo ai colori, è uno dei concetti piu basilari di ACtools
si usano x fare bot pesca, auto pozza, auto spamm...

i colori che supporta sono:

il nero
il blu
il verde
il grigio
il rosso
il bianko

come ho accennato in precedenza ogni pixel ha un prprio colore ci sono

dei comandi che controlla che nella coordinata (trovabile cn ctrl+m)
ci sia o meno quel colore si interpretano iscolore + coordinata
i comandi sono:

isblack = il pixel è nero?
isblue = il pixel è blu?
isgreen = il pixel è verde?
isred = il pixel è rosso?
iswhite = il pixel è bianko?

Es ISblack 600,500
chide se la coordinata 600, 500 è nera e se lo è esegue una determinata

opzione.

vi chiederete a cosa serva? allora vi faccio un bell esempio

auto pozza:
isblack 500, 600
keys 11111111111111
end
restart

semplicissimo e corto:
se la coordinata 500,600 (coordinata sparata), cioè la coordinata dove ce

la vita che è rossa diventa x caso nera scatta keys 11111111111 che se

nel tasto rapido ci sono delle pezze rosse verranno utilizzate e gli hp

ripristinati, in piu continua a restartizarsi.

l'opzione che esegue iscolore deve essere dento end tutto quello che gli

è fuari verra eseguito anke se il pixel nn è nero.

una ultima funzione che serve a moltissimo è una funzione che si chiama:

else = se così nn fosse allora

per esempio un bot che controlla che nel primo slot dell'inventario ce

qualcosa o meno, se ce la preme oppure lascia stare lo slot vuoto, viene

comunemente usata x i bot pesca:

//(coordinata sparata)
isblack 500, 600
restart
else
mousepos 500, 600
delay 300
rightclick
end
restart

allora dice
isblack 500,600 la coordinata è nera allora

restart ricomincia da capo

else se così nn fosse allora

mousepos 500, 600 vai in quella coordinata

delay 300 aspetta 1/3 di secondo (se così nn fosse il comando sarebbe

troppo veloce e in alcuni casi nn lo esegue, qui si parla in milli

secondi quindi muoverebbe il mouse e cliccerebbe in un millesimo di

secondo!!!)

rightclick premi il tasto destro

end dentro isblack nn ci sono piu finzioni cio che viene adesso sarà

eseguito comunque

restart ricomincia da capo...

oppure un esempio semplice semplice

//(coordinata sparata)
auto pozza cn else:
isred 500,600 // il pixel è rosso?
restart // si lo è allora ricomincia
else // se così nn fosse allora
keys 11111111111111 / /premi 1111111 dove ce la pozza
end //fine funzioni di isred
restart // ricomincia



tutto cio che è preceduto da // è testo che o "commento" che il programma

nn prende in considerazione quidi ci potete scrivere quello che volete

finito, in teoria ora dovreste essere capaci di utilizzare actool o

quasi.

nbbbb:
Actools ha altre quarantine di funzioni io vi ho elencato le principali x

fare dei bot poi cio che riuscirete a creare con le vostre mani da

artista si vedrà solo cn la pratica, e se nn vi e chiaro il concetto di

end è normalissimo all'inizzio =).

quando sarete capaci di farci quei bot lunghi 3 pagine allora potrete

passare all' autoit quello che sto studiando io adesso dalla quida creata

da
red skull ripeto red skull nn da me da red skull capito red skull!
ci tiene tanto che si dica il suo nome xke ci ha passato parecchio per

crearla,
trovabile qui:
[Devi essere iscritto e connesso per vedere questo link]
oppure qui sul nostro sito :
Creare un cheat per metin2

appena sarò in grado di gestire bene il autoit passo al vb =|

per eventuali orrori ortografici, incomprensioni, commenti, spam,

suggerimenti, proteste io nn sono disponibile e sarò infelicissimo di

ascltarvi asd asd asd asd asd asd asd asd

spero che sii utile...
avatar
xXPownerXx
Fondatore
Fondatore

Messaggi : 115
Data d'iscrizione : 08.12.09
Età : 27
Località : Bari

http://cheatsitalian.uniogame.com

Tornare in alto Andare in basso

Vedere l'argomento precedente Vedere l'argomento seguente Tornare in alto

- Argomenti simili

 
Permessi di questa sezione del forum:
Non puoi rispondere agli argomenti in questo forum